Seána Kerslake brings an edge and unpredictability that animates a carefully shaded story
The gig-jobbing Eileen agrees to taxi Shane between the North Down village of the title and Belfast, where he is failing miserably at a community comedy course. What follows traverses the entire spectrum of depression, as her acerbic defence mechanisms are met and matched by his melancholy. She dismisses his sorrow as martyrdom; he recognises her as broken.
Shot in a muted palette by cinematographer Federico Cesca, everything about Ballywalter is commendably understated. Kielty, an accomplished comedian, firmly sits on his jazz hands and performs some of the worst stand-up routines in the history of comedy. Kerslake brings an edge and unpredictability that animates a carefully shaded story. The specifics of place have their own texture; seldom has a script encompassed such a variety of uses for the great Ulster standard: ballbag.
